| Abstract | We propose a novel approach for target detection based on quantum coherence. We exploit a time-bin quantum interferometer to create sequences of coherent optical pulses that are sent towards a target. The photons scattered off the target are then analyzed, and the observed coherence is used as a parameter to distinguish signal photons from noise photons. We confirm experimentally that coherence-based detection achieves a better performance than conventional intensity-based detection. We believe our method will open up new application avenues of coherence to quantum sensing, imaging, and communication. |
